Coupland steps up to manager

PETER Coupland is the new manager of Chatham Town. Following the resignation of Steve Hearn last week, the club believe Coupland’s promotion from assistant to manager is exactly what the team needs in their bid to stay in the Dr Martens, Eastern Division.

Chats vice-chairman Barry Adams said: “Peter's experience as assistant manager and his knowledge of the club is more of a benefit to the club’s expectations than to seek a successor elsewhere. We wish him every success.”

Coupland said: “I'm delighted although it’s obviously a challenge. I want plenty of hard work and discipline from my players but I’m really looking forward to it now.”
